The Syrian civil defense reported that six civilians were injured by the explosion of
04:56
mines and bombs left over from the war in rural areas of the northern province of Idlib.
05:02
Four youths were injured when a mine exploded while they were removing debris from their
05:06
home in southern Idlib.
05:08
Likewise, the two minors were injured in two separate explosions of a grenade and a closer
05:13
bomb, respectively, in the municipality of Areha.
05:17
Civil defense reported that more than 30 people were killed and over 40 injured between late
05:21
2024 and early 2025 in explosions of the objects left over from the armed conflict
05:27
that erupted in 2011.
05:29
The current scenario makes it difficult for displaced people to return to their homes
05:33
and for agricultural land to be developed.

On Sunday, U.S. authorities reported at least 11 people killed as a result of a severe cold
12:17
wave that hit the southeastern region of the country.
12:21
The deaths were recorded in the states of Alabama, Georgia, Texas and South Carolina,
12:25
most of them due to hypothermia and car accidents following landslides on the highways.
12:31
In New Orleans, Louisiana and parts of the state of Florida, the cold storm brought the
12:36
heaviest snowfall recorded in the last 130 years.
12:41
In this sense, we offer this issue an extreme cold warning from the state of Mississippi
12:46
to the Florida panhandle.
